i would call GPI or Cam Motion and tell them what your plans are with the car, race weight, gearing, trans setup and have them grind one made specifically for your car. They'll select the matching springs as well. As far as the package, its cheap insurance to go with new cam/crank gears, C5.R timing chain, and a high volume oil pump
depending on the mileage of the engine, and how much spin, new lifters. a lot of guys overlook the benefits/importance of quality lifters. You can go with chevrolet performance #12499225 at minimum or go with some johnsons if you want a bit better quality. If you're girl is gonna be a screamer and about that 7500 to 8000 life, jonshon race
